April 22, 2010
The Mid-Atlantic Glass Association held its 23rd Annual Glass Expo on April 21 at Martin’s Crosswinds, Greenbelt, Md. Seventy companies exhibited at the show, and 809 people attended. April 19, 2010
According to Tracy Rogers, technical director, Edgetech I.G., Cambridge, Ohio, condensation is the third thermal performance parameter alongside U-factor and solar heat gain coefficient.
